What Every Property Owner Should Know About Fire

Before you are ever faced with a need for fire damage cleanup in Johns Creek, it is essential to know some staggering fire-related statistics. Our AdvantaClean of Norcross and Buford team has put together some staggering information any property owner should know:

  • Out of residential fires, the top three causes include electrical malfunctions, heating equipment, and cooking.

  • Within the United States, a house fire breaks out every 87 seconds. 

  • The heat from a structure fire can reach over 1,000 degrees F in under five minutes.

  • Thanksgiving is the peak day each year for cooking fires across America.

  • Every year, roughly 18,000 fires start because of fireworks.

Fires can engulf and ultimately destroy a building. However, there are many instances where the fire damage could be minimal. Sometimes, the damage might even be unnoticed until hidden issues arise or you notice the smell of smoke months later. Because of this, hiring our skilled technicians to handle your fire and smoke remediation and cleanup needs will help you to avoid unseen hazards such as:

  • Damage to the electrical wiring throughout your home

  • Compromised HVAC systems and ductwork

  • Damage to the piping in your home

  • Hidden structural issues

During any fire, sort particles and other toxic gases enter the atmosphere and pose a risk for inhalation. It is best to consider professional fire damage restoration regardless of the size or scope of the fire event that took place.

Are you still unsure if you need expert fire damage assistance for your Johns Creek property? These are some things to look for:

  • Soot stains on various surfaces, including ceilings, walls, and floors

  • Metal surface rusting, as this might be a chemical reaction after a fire

  • Odd odors

  • Changes in the building structure, such as small changes in door frames or cracks in ceilings/walls
